Strikes and Kicks
When it concerns self-defense, strikes and kicks are important techniques that can effectively disarm an enemy.
In an unsafe circumstance, your capacity to strike with accuracy and power can be the distinction between running away unharmed and coming to be a target.
Strikes include utilizing your hands, elbows, knees, or even your head to provide effective blows to vulnerable areas of the body, such as the nose, throat, or groin.
Kicks, on the other hand, utilize the toughness of your legs to supply strong strikes to a challenger's legs, upper body, or head.
By combining proper technique with rate and precision, you can rapidly disable an enemy and produce a chance to escape.
Bear in mind to aim for prone locations and utilize your body's natural tools to your benefit.

Defensive Maneuvers and Escapes
To properly protect yourself in a dangerous scenario, it's vital to grasp protective maneuvers and gets away. These methods are created to assist you avert and conquer an opponent quickly and successfully.
One reliable protective maneuver is the avoid. By stepping sideways, you can prevent an approaching attack and develop a chance to counterattack.
